What is bitcoin mining eli5 health

Tap here to turn on desktop notifications to get what is bitcoin mining eli5 health news sent straight to you. Bitcoin may be the next big thing in finance, but it can be difficult for most people to understand how it works. There is a whole lot of maths and numbers involved, things which normally make a lot of people run in fear. Well, it’s one of the most complex parts of Bitcoin, but it is also the most critical to its success.

As you know, Bitcoin is a digital currency. Currencies need checks and balances, validation and verification. Normally central governments and banks are the ones who perform these tasks, making their currencies difficult to forge while also keeping track of them. The big difference with Bitcoin is that it is decentralized.

If there is no central government regulating it, then how do we know that the transactions are accurate? How do we know that person A has sent 1 bitcoin to person B? How do we stop person A from also sending that bitcoin to person C? One of the most common analogies that people use for Bitcoin is that it’s like mining gold.

Apart from that, Bitcoin actually works quite differently and it’s actually quite genius once you can get your head around it. One of the major differences is that mining doesn’t necessarily create the bitcoin. Bitcoin mining requires a computer and a special program. Miners will use this program and a lot of computer resources to compete with other miners in solving complicated mathematical problems. About every ten minutes, they will try to solve a block that has the latest transaction data in it, using cryptographic hash functions. A cryptographic hash function is an essentially one-way encryption without a key. It takes an input and returns a seemingly random, but fixed length hash value.

If you change even one letter of the original input, a completely different hash value will be returned. This randomness makes it impossible to predict what the output will be. How Are Hash Functions Useful For Bitcoin? Because it is practically impossible to predict the outcome of input, hash functions can be used for proof of work and validation. The difficulty of these puzzles is measurable. However, they cannot be cheated on. This is because there is no way to perform better than by guessing blindly.